CLE - Drafting Separation Agreements Reached Via Mediation

06/12/2013 - 4:00 PM to 7:00 PM
Mediation is gaining traction as the preferred way for divorcing couples to resolve their issues. With rising legal costs and busy court dockets, mediation is often a less expensive and more efficient alternative for clients seeking a divorce. It is increasingly common that divorcing couples utilize the services of a mediator at some juncture on their path to divorce. Mediators who help memorialize clients' agreements in writing and attorneys who use these written agreements to craft separation agreements will benefit from this program ...

A Reception to Honor Chief Justice Paula Carey

06/19/2013 - 5:30 PM to 7:30 PM
On Monday, May 20, 2013, Paula M. Carey, currently the Chief Justice of the Probate and Family Court, was appointed by the Supreme Judicial Court to serve as the new Chief Justice of the Trial Court, effective July 16, 2013. Chief Justice Carey has provided the Probate and Family Court with seven years of exemplary leadership. Her tenure as chief has seen the implementation of important reforms especially in a time of sparse resources. Please join us in congratulating her on her selection and thanking her for her many years of service to the Probate and Family Court....
